Frequently Asked Questions

How far is Annaba from Istanbul?

The flight distance from Rabah Bitat Airport (AAE) to Istanbul Airport (IST) is 1,164 miles (1,874 km). This is the great circle distance calculated using the Vincenty formula.

How long is the flight?

A direct flight takes approximately 2h 52m. This is a medium-haul flight typically cruising at 37,000 feet (FL370).
